Add ANY logic for local builds.
For ANY paths, we find the first dev or test image that exists in the
local dir and return that path. This is useful for developers who may
have a dev or test image and more flexible than our previous assumption
that all devs wanted test images.
BUG=chromium:275702
TEST=unittests + 2 updates via AU client one with just a dev image, and one
with just a test image. Both succeeded!
